City Statistics and Other Information About Geneva
Demographics
From a total population of 18,940, Geneva has a median age of 45. The average age of males, in Geneva, is 43 while the average age of females is 46. When you compare the median age of men and women in Geneva, there is an average difference of 2.63 years.
Income
The median income of individuals, in Geneva, is $81,932 while the average household income is $131,756. In 2029, the average income per capita for Geneva is expected to be $81,932.
